June 24, 2022 – The Midland City Clerk’s Office will begin mailing absentee ballots for the August 2, 2022 State Primary Election this week to absentee voters who have returned their applications to vote by absentee ballot.
Absentee ballot applications will be processed in the order they were received. To track if an application has been received, a ballot has been mailed, or if a ballot has been delivered back to the Clerk’s Office, visit the Michigan Voter Information Website (MVIC) found at https://mvic.sos.state.mi.us/.
Absentee ballots will arrive by mail in a white envelope with a blue stripe on the left side labeled “Official Absent Voter Ballot”. The envelope will contain the ballot and another white envelope with a purple stripe on the left side which should be signed and used to return the completed ballot back to the City Clerk’s Office.
Voters may obtain an application to vote by absentee ballot online at https://mvic.sos.state.mi.us/ or by request at the Midland City Clerk’s Office, 333 W. Ellsworth Street, Midland, MI 48640; (989) 837-3310.
Completed absentee ballots must be received by the City Clerk’s Office by 8 p.m. on Election Day in order to be counted. The City Clerk’s Office recommends allowing 2 weeks’ mailing time for returning voted ballots by mail. Return postage is required to mail back an absentee ballot.
A ballot drop box is available outside the Larkin Street entrance of City Hall for city of Midland residents to submit voting materials. Voters should not use the payment drop box inside the doors of City Hall to return election materials as they will not fit and may become damaged and unable to be processed.
Following the passage of Proposal 3, all registered Michigan voters are now eligible to vote by absentee ballot.
